But then, at the same time, you need to be analytical … WebbThey listen to sentences in which the meaning changes depending on which word is stressed. They practise using sentence stress by saying sentences aloud, changing the stress in order to convey different meanings. They write short scripts in which the use of sentence stress is necessary in order to convey meaning. WebbPoint out that in theatre, words that are emphasized are sometimes called “power words”. A director or vocal coach may ask an actor to look in a sentence for the “power word”, or to “look for the line’s power.” Demonstration/Guided Practice Write, “My dog has fleas” on the board. Don’t use punctuation. Proxemics is the art in theatre of expressing meaning according to the space between characters (I love you, I hate you, I’m afraid of you). Pausing for Emphasis. This pause will usually be a bit longer than a punctuated pause. It allows for the mental traffic of the words in the audience brain to clear for the main point to enter and be absorbed. The dramatic points should be few so, these pauses should be too. aldi cugnaux
